Definitions for "Artiodactyls"
Even-toed hoofed mammals; the mammalian order that includes hippopotamuses, pigs, peccaries, camels, chevrotains, cattle, antelopes, deer, giraffes. Among living mammals, probably the closest relatives of whales. ("Encyclopedia of Marine Mammals," William F. Perrin, Bernd Wursig and J.G.M. Thewissen, Academic Press, 2002, p. 1348.)
terrestrial herbivorous mammals characterized by having an even number of toes and by having the main limb axes pass between the third and fourth toes examples include: hippos (4 toes), deer, sheep, antelope, goats (2 toes)
